How to Factory Reset the Galaxy Note 5

At some point, you will want to make your phone as clean as the day you got it. Whether you’re selling or giving your device away when upgrading, or you just want to start fresh, here’s how to reset your Samsung Galaxy S6 to factory settings:

 

 

  1. Before factory resetting your phone, make sure you have backed up or downloaded any data you want to preserve, such as photos and videos.
  2. Open the Settings app and swipe to the Personal page.
  3. Tap on Backup and Reset.
  4. You are presented with a list detailing everything that will be erased from your phone. Tap RESET DEVICE at the bottom of the screen.
  5. If you have set up the fingerprint scanner, you will be asked to confirm your fingerprint.
  6. Your device will begin the reset process. When finished, the phone will operate just like the day you got it, and starts into the phone setup process.
